How do classical Greek political structures compare with those of classical Rome

The ancient Roman and Greek civilizations had well-organized political processes that greatly influenced the manner in which later governments were structured in Europe and the United States. The system of political parties, the establishment of divisions in government -- even political words such as democracy, monarchy and tyranny -- originated in ancient Rome and Greece. Although Rome drew many of its political principles from the Greeks, and as a result, developed a government similar to that of Greece, there were several differences between the two.

Why did the famous 1936 Literary Digest straw poll fail to predict the winner of the presidential election?
Katarina [22]
C). It failed to poll poor voters, because the names of the mailing list for the poll were taken from phone directories/magazine subscribers/etc., which tended to just be composed of middle-class/upper-class voters since they were the ones who could afford it
